Back to Blogs

Ein umfassender Leitfaden zur Befragung von Flutter-Entwicklern in Indien

Written by
Aditya Nagpal
9
min read
Published on
March 23, 2026
Hiring and Talent Acquisition

Einführung

In der sich ständig weiterentwickelnden Landschaft der Entwicklung mobiler Apps deuten Schätzungen darauf hin, dass 91% der Entwickler glaube, dass die Verwendung von Flutter zwischen 20 und 50% der Entwicklungszeit für MVPs im Vergleich zur nativen App-Entwicklung einsparen kann. Das von Google entwickelte Open-Source-Framework erfreut sich bei Entwicklern und Unternehmen weltweit großer Beliebtheit. Bekannt für seine plattformübergreifenden Funktionen und schönen, nativ kompilierten Anwendungen, hat es seine Popularität als plattformübergreifendes mobiles Framework mit über 42% von Entwicklern, die erklären, dass sie Flutter verwenden und andere Frameworks hinter sich lassen.

Den Richtigen einstellen Flutter-Entwickler in Indien, ein Land, das für seinen wachsenden Pool an Tech-Talenten bekannt ist, kann ein herausforderndes und doch lohnendes Unterfangen sein. Egal, ob Sie ein globaler Personalmanager sind, der die blühende Entwickler-Community Indiens nutzen möchte, oder ein in Indien ansässiges Unternehmen, das ein starkes internes Flutter-Team aufbauen möchte, es ist wichtig, den Bewertungsprozess zu verstehen.

Warum es wichtig ist, Flutter-Entwickler zu bewerten

Strukturierte Interviews spielen eine zentrale Rolle im Einstellungsprozess für Flutter-Entwickler in Indien, unabhängig von ihrem Niveau (Junior, Mid oder Senior). Diese Interviews dienen als Lackmustest für die technischen Fähigkeiten, Problemlösungsfähigkeiten und die kulturelle Eignung der Kandidaten in die Organisation. Die Bedeutung dieser Interviews kann nicht genug betont werden, da sie sich direkt auf die Qualität Ihrer App-Entwicklungsprojekte und den langfristigen Erfolg Ihres Teams auswirken können.

In diesem umfassenden Leitfaden werden wir uns mit den Feinheiten der Befragung von Flutter-Entwicklern in Indien auf allen Erfahrungsstufen befassen. Egal, ob Sie neue Talente einstellen, Ihr mittleres Team erweitern möchten oder erfahrene Experten für Führungspositionen suchen, dieser Blog ist Ihre Anlaufstelle. Wir bieten Ihnen wertvolle Einblicke in die Erstellung maßgeschneiderter Interviewfragen, die Ihnen helfen, die richtige Wahl für Ihr Unternehmen zu finden.

Überblick über den Interviewprozess

Die Einstellung von Flutter-Entwicklern in Indien oder anderswo beinhaltet einen strukturierten Interviewprozess, bei dem die Kandidaten in verschiedenen Phasen bewertet werden. Dieser Ansatz stellt sicher, dass Sie nicht nur die technischen Fähigkeiten bewerten, sondern auch Einblicke in die Problemlösungsfähigkeiten, die Teamfähigkeit und die kulturelle Eignung eines Kandidaten in Ihr Unternehmen erhalten. Hier ist ein Überblick über den typischen Interviewprozess für Flutter-Entwickler:

Durch die Durchführung dieses umfassenden Interviewprozesses können Unternehmen sicherstellen, dass sie nicht nur die Flutter-Expertise der Kandidaten bewerten, sondern auch ihre Fähigkeit, effektiv zum Team und zu den Zielen der Organisation beizutragen. Die verschiedenen Phasen ermöglichen eine ganzheitliche Bewertung, bei der sowohl die technischen Fähigkeiten als auch die zwischenmenschlichen Fähigkeiten berücksichtigt werden.

Interviewfragen für Flutter-Entwickler auf Junior-Ebene

Junior Flutter-Entwickler stehen in der Regel am Anfang ihrer Karriere und verfügen über grundlegende Kenntnisse in Flutter und der Entwicklung mobiler Apps. Sie haben möglicherweise nur begrenzte praktische Erfahrung, sollten jedoch ein gutes Verständnis der Grundlagen nachweisen.

Zuständigkeiten:

  • Implementieren Sie grundlegende UI-Designs mithilfe von Flutter-Widgets.
  • Arbeiten Sie an kleineren, klar definierten App-Komponenten oder -Modulen.
  • Arbeiten Sie eng mit hochrangigen Teammitgliedern zusammen und befolgen Sie die Codierungsrichtlinien.
  • Beheben Sie einfache Fehler und beheben Sie sie.
  • Lernen Sie und passen Sie sich an Best Practices und neue Flutter-Trends an.
Interview Questions for Junior level Flutter Developers

Beispiel für eine Frage zur Programmierrunde für einen Flutter-Entwickler auf Junior-Ebene

Frage:

Sie haben die Aufgabe, eine einfache Flutter-App zu erstellen, die das Faktorielle einer Zahl berechnet. Implementieren Sie eine Flutter-App mit den folgenden Anforderungen:

  • Erstellen Sie eine Benutzeroberfläche mit einem Textfeld zur Eingabe einer Zahl und einer Schaltfläche zur Berechnung des Faktors.
  • Wenn der Benutzer eine Zahl eingibt und auf die Schaltfläche tippt, zeigen Sie den Faktor der Zahl in einem Text-Widget unten an.
  • Stellen Sie sicher, dass die App Randfälle wie negative Zahlen und Eingaben, die keine Ganzzahlen sind, ordnungsgemäß behandelt. Zeigt eine Fehlermeldung für ungültige Eingaben an.

Interviewfragen für Flutter-Entwickler auf mittlerer Ebene

Flutter-Entwickler auf mittlerer Ebene haben umfangreiche Erfahrung und Kenntnisse in Flutter gesammelt. Sie sind in der Lage, komplexere Aufgaben zu bewältigen, architektonische Entscheidungen zu treffen und die Skalierbarkeit und Wartbarkeit von Apps sicherzustellen.

Zuständigkeiten:

  • Entwerfen und implementieren Sie App-Architekturen und UI-Layouts.
  • Leitet die Entwicklungsbemühungen bei mittleren bis großen Projekten.
  • Mentor junger Entwickler und biete Beratung an.
  • Optimieren Sie die Leistung und Reaktionsfähigkeit Ihrer Apps.
  • Arbeiten Sie mit funktionsübergreifenden Teams zusammen, darunter Designern und Backend-Entwicklern.
Interview Questions for Mid-level Flutter Developers

Beispiel für eine Frage zur Programmierrunde für einen Flutter-Entwickler auf mittlerer Ebene

Frage:

Sie haben die Aufgabe, eine Flutter-App zu erstellen, die eine Liste von Beiträgen von einer RESTful-API abruft und anzeigt. Implementieren Sie eine Flutter-App mit den folgenden Anforderungen:

  • Erstellen Sie eine Benutzeroberfläche mit einer ListView, um eine Liste von Beiträgen anzuzeigen.
  • Rufen Sie Daten vom bereitgestellten RESTful-API-Endpunkt ab (z. B. https://jsonplaceholder.typicode.com/posts) und parse es in eine Liste von Post-Objekten.
  • Zeigen Sie den Titel und den Text jedes Beitrags in einem ListTile innerhalb der ListView an.
  • Implementieren Sie einen Pull-to-Refresh-Mechanismus, der es Benutzern ermöglicht, die Liste der Beiträge zu aktualisieren.
  • Behandeln Sie potenzielle Netzwerkfehler und zeigen Sie bei Bedarf eine Fehlermeldung oder eine Wiederholungsoption an.

Interviewfragen für Flutter-Entwickler auf höherer Ebene

Erfahrene Flutter-Entwickler sind Experten für Flutter und verfügen über ein tiefes Verständnis der Prinzipien der Entwicklung mobiler Apps. Sie verfügen über einen reichen Erfahrungsschatz und eine Erfolgsbilanz bei der erfolgreichen Bereitstellung hochwertiger, komplexer Flutter-Anwendungen.

Zuständigkeiten:

  • Entwerfen und überwachen Sie die Entwicklung großer Flutter-Apps auf Unternehmensebene.
  • Definieren Sie Best Practices, Codierungsstandards und Entwicklungsworkflows.
  • Beheben und beheben Sie komplexe Probleme und optimieren Sie so die App-Leistung.
  • Mentor und trainiere Entwickler auf Junior- und Mid-Level-Ebene.
  • Arbeiten Sie mit Stakeholdern zusammen, um Projektziele und -strategien zu definieren.
Interview Questions for Senior level Flutter Developers

Beispiel für eine Frage zur Programmierrunde für einen Flutter-Entwickler auf Senior-Ebene

Frage:

Sie haben die Aufgabe, eine Flutter-App zum Verwalten und Anzeigen einer Aufgabenliste zu erstellen. Implementieren Sie eine Flutter-App mit den folgenden Anforderungen:

  • Erstellen Sie eine Benutzeroberfläche mit einer Liste von Aufgaben, die in einer ListView angezeigt werden.
  • Implementieren Sie eine lokale SQLite-Datenbank zum Speichern und Abrufen von Aufgaben.
  • Jede Aufgabe sollte einen Titel, eine Beschreibung und einen Abschlussstatus (erledigt oder rückgängig gemacht) haben.
  • Erlauben Sie Benutzern, neue Aufgaben hinzuzufügen, Aufgaben als abgeschlossen oder unvollständig zu markieren und Aufgaben zu löschen.
  • Implementieren Sie eine Suchfunktion, die Aufgaben nach Titel oder Beschreibung filtert.
  • Stellen Sie sicher, dass die App responsiv ist und sowohl Hoch- als auch Querformat unterstützt.

Diese Codierungsfrage bewertet die Fähigkeit eines erfahrenen Flutter-Entwicklers, mit SQLite-Datenbanken zu arbeiten, komplexe Zustände zu verwalten, eine ansprechende Benutzeroberfläche zu erstellen und CRUD-Operationen (Create, Read, Update, Delete) in einer Flutter-App abzuwickeln.

Zugang zu Soft Skills und kultureller Eignung bei der Einstellung von Flutter-Entwicklern

Bei der Einstellung von Flutter-Entwicklern ist es von entscheidender Bedeutung, Kandidaten auf ihre sozialen Fähigkeiten und ihre kulturelle Eignung hin zu beurteilen, da so sichergestellt wird, dass sie nicht nur über die für die Stelle erforderlichen technischen Fähigkeiten verfügen, sondern auch über die Eigenschaften und Werte verfügen, die für den Erfolg in Ihrem Unternehmen erforderlich sind. Hier erfahren Sie, warum dies wichtig ist und wie Sie es in den Interviewprozess integrieren können:

Bedeutung von Soft Skills und kultureller Eignung:

  • Teamzusammenarbeit: Die Flutter-Entwicklung beinhaltet oft die Arbeit in funktionsübergreifenden Teams. Kandidaten mit ausgeprägten sozialen Fähigkeiten wie Kommunikation, Zusammenarbeit und Empathie sind besser in der Lage, effektiv mit Designern, Produktmanagern und anderen Entwicklern zusammenzuarbeiten.
  • Anpassungsfähigkeit: Soziale Fähigkeiten wie Anpassungsfähigkeit und Lernbereitschaft sind in der sich schnell entwickelnden Welt der Entwicklung mobiler Apps unerlässlich. Entwickler müssen sich mit neuen Technologien und Ansätzen vertraut machen.
  • Problemlösung: Effektive Fähigkeiten zur Problemlösung gehen über das Programmieren hinaus. Die Kandidaten sollten in der Lage sein, kritisch zu denken, Probleme zu analysieren und kreative Lösungen zu finden, sowohl einzeln als auch innerhalb eines Teams.
  • Kulturelle Ausrichtung: Kulturelle Anpassung stellt sicher, dass die Werte und der Arbeitsstil eines Bewerbers mit der Unternehmenskultur übereinstimmen, wodurch ein positives Arbeitsumfeld gefördert und Konflikte reduziert werden.

Einbeziehung von Soft Skills und Bewertung der kulturellen Eignung:

Verhaltensfragen: Nehmen Sie Verhaltensfragen in den Interviewprozess auf, um zu beurteilen, wie Kandidaten in der Vergangenheit mit bestimmten Situationen umgegangen sind. Zum Beispiel:

  • „Können Sie uns ein Beispiel nennen, in dem Sie einen Konflikt innerhalb Ihres Teams lösen mussten? Wie sind Sie daran herangegangen?“
  • „Erzählen Sie uns von einer Zeit, in der Sie vor einer schwierigen Projektfrist standen. Wie haben Sie Ihre Zeit und Prioritäten verwaltet?“

Szenariobasierte Bewertungen: Erstellen Sie reale Szenarien, die die Herausforderungen nachahmen, denen Entwickler in Ihrem Unternehmen begegnen könnten. Stellen Sie beispielsweise ein hypothetisches Szenario vor, in dem sich eine Projektfrist nähert und der Kunde eine Änderung in letzter Minute anfordert. Fragen Sie, wie der Kandidat mit dieser Situation umgehen würde.

Rollenspezifische Fragen: Passen Sie die Fragen an die Rolle und ihre Aufgaben an. Als Flutter-Entwickler fragst du vielleicht nach seiner Erfahrung in der Zusammenarbeit mit Designern oder nach seinem Ansatz zur Optimierung der App-Leistung.

Vorstellungsgespräche bei Cultural Fit: Führen Sie Interviews durch, die sich speziell auf die kulturelle Ausrichtung konzentrieren. Teilen Sie die Werte Ihres Unternehmens mit und fragen Sie die Kandidaten, in welcher Beziehung sie zu ihnen stehen. Zum Beispiel: „Unser Unternehmen legt Wert auf Innovation und Zusammenarbeit. Können Sie uns Beispiele nennen, in denen Sie zu innovativen Lösungen beigetragen oder mit anderen zusammengearbeitet haben?“

Referenzprüfungen: Wenden Sie sich an die Referenzen des Bewerbers, um von früheren Arbeitgebern oder Kollegen Einblicke in seine sozialen Fähigkeiten und seine kulturelle Eignung zu erhalten.

Tools zur Bewertung: Erwägen Sie die Durchführung von Persönlichkeitstests oder Umfragen zur kulturellen Eignung, um Kandidaten objektiv zu bewerten. Tools wie der Culture Index oder der Predictive Index können wertvolle Erkenntnisse liefern.

Podiumsgespräche: Beziehen Sie mehrere Teammitglieder in den Interviewprozess ein, um unterschiedliche Meinungen zu den sozialen Fähigkeiten und der kulturellen Eignung des Kandidaten einzuholen.

Feedback und Diskussion: Ermutigen Sie die Interviewer nach jedem Interview, Feedback zu den sozialen Fähigkeiten und der kulturellen Ausrichtung des Bewerbers zu geben. Führen Sie Diskussionen, um einen Konsens über die Eignung des Bewerbers zu erzielen.

Die Einbeziehung dieser Bewertungen in Ihren Interviewprozess stellt sicher, dass Sie nicht nur technisch versierte Flutter-Entwickler einstellen, sondern auch Personen, die effektiv mit Ihrem Team zusammenarbeiten und positiv zur Unternehmenskultur beitragen können.

Fazit

Die Einstellung des richtigen Flutter-Entwicklers ist entscheidend für den Erfolg Ihres Projekts. Die Durchführung eines strukturierten und gründlichen Interviewprozesses ist der erste Schritt zur Identifizierung hochkarätiger Talente. In diesem umfassenden Leitfaden haben wir uns mit den wichtigsten Interviewfragen zur Bewertung der technischen und verhaltensbezogenen Fähigkeiten von Flutter-Entwicklern in Indien befasst. Wir haben auch besprochen, wie wichtig es ist, den Interviewprozess auf jüngere und leitende Rollen zuzuschneiden und sicherzustellen, dass Sie die richtigen Fähigkeiten für jedes Level bewerten.

Wenn Sie weitere Fragen zum Einstellungsprozess für Flutter-Entwickler in Indien haben, wenden Sie sich bitte wenden Sie sich an uns und wir helfen Ihnen gerne weiter.

Häufig gestellte Fragen

Was macht Flutter zu einer beliebten Wahl für die Entwicklung mobiler Apps?

Flutter ermöglicht eine schnellere Entwicklung, schöne, nativ kompilierte Apps auf mehreren Plattformen aus einer einzigen Codebasis heraus und bietet breite Community-Unterstützung, sodass Entwickler die MVP-Entwicklungszeit um 20 bis 50% reduzieren können.

Warum ist die Bewertung von Flutter-Entwicklern für den Einstellungsprozess von entscheidender Bedeutung?

Strukturierte Interviews helfen dabei, die technischen Fähigkeiten, Problemlösungsfähigkeiten und die kulturelle Eignung der Kandidaten zu bewerten. So wird sichergestellt, dass Unternehmen kompetente Entwickler auswählen, die effektiv zu Projekten und Teams beitragen können.

Was sind die wichtigsten Aufgaben, die von Flutter-Entwicklern auf Junior-Ebene erwartet werden?

Junior-Entwickler implementieren in der Regel die grundlegende Benutzeroberfläche mithilfe von Flutter-Widgets, arbeiten an kleinen Modulen, arbeiten mit Senioren zusammen, beheben einfache Fehler und passen sich an die sich weiterentwickelnden Best Practices von Flutter an.

Wie unterscheiden sich Flutter-Entwickler auf mittlerer Ebene in Bezug auf Rolle und Fähigkeiten von Junioren?

Entwickler auf mittlerer Ebene entwerfen App-Architekturen, leiten mittlere bis große Projekte, betreuen Junioren, optimieren die App-Leistung und arbeiten teamübergreifend zusammen, um skalierbare Lösungen zu entwickeln.

Welches Fachwissen bringen leitende Flutter-Entwickler in ein Team ein?

Erfahrene Entwickler entwerfen Flutter-Apps auf Unternehmensebene, definieren Codierungsstandards, optimieren die Leistung, betreuen Teams und stimmen die Entwicklung auf die Geschäftsziele und -strategien ab.

Können Sie Beispiele für Codierungsaufgaben nennen, die für verschiedene Flutter-Entwicklerstufen typisch sind?

Junior: Erstellen Sie einen Faktorrechner mit Eingabevalidierung; Mittleres Niveau: Erstellen Sie eine App, die Beiträge aus einer REST-API mit Pull-to-Refresh auflistet; Senior: Entwickeln Sie einen Task-Manager mit SQLite-Datenbank, CRUD-Operationen, Suche und responsiver Benutzeroberfläche.

Warum ist die Bewertung von Soft Skills und kultureller Eignung bei der Einstellung von Flutter-Entwicklern wichtig?

Starke Kommunikation, Teamwork, Anpassungsfähigkeit, Problemlösung und kulturelle Ausrichtung fördern eine effektive Zusammenarbeit, ein positives Arbeitsumfeld und reduzieren die Fluktuation in den Flutter-Entwicklungsteams.

Related Blogs